CUORE crystal validation runs: Results on radioactive contamination and extrapolation to CUORE background
The CUORE Crystal Validation Runs (CCVRs) have been carried out since the end of 2008 at the Gran Sasso National Laboratories, in order to test the performance and the radiopurity of the TeO2 crystals produced at SICCAS (Shanghai Institute of Ceramics, Chinese Academy of Sciences) for the CUORE experiment. CUORE is a cryogenic-bolometer detector consisting of 988 TeO 2 crystals, 750 g each, operated at a temperature of ∼8 mK, currently under construction in the underground Laboratori Nazionali del Gran Sasso. The CUORE (Cryogenic Underground Observatory for Rare Events) experiment projects to construct and operate an array of 1000 cryogenic thermal detectors of a mass of 760 g each to investigate rare events physics, in particular, double beta decay and non baryonic particle dark matter. Cryogenic bolometers, with their excellent energy resolution, flexibility in material, and availability in high purity, are excellent detectors for the search for neutrinoless double beta decay. Kilogram-size single crystals of TeO2 are utilized in CUORICINO for an array with a total detector mass of 40.7 kg.
